WA0KBT Rating: 2013-04-19
Good amp, but if buying used - check main transformer brand Time Owned: more than 12 months.
This is the best amp I have owned and the only one that worked perfect on every band I have used it on (I dont use 160) Mine is 9 years old and at that time was made by Cross Link. But....I recently had the main power transformer HV winding fail. Very costly item and not one you would expect to fail. Alpha (RF Concepts) tech support advised that for a period of time Cross Link used transformers made by Magnelab and had alot of problems. Apparently many were replaced on warranty but mine lasted longer. So if you are buying an older one 2nd hand you might check to see if the main transf is a Magnelab....could be a time bomb waiting to happen. Otherwise a great amp.

K4BOF Rating: 2013-01-20
Alpha 99,...a Tried and True Amplifier Time Owned: 3 to 6 months.
Considering the many HF amplifiers out there, I decided to step up to a full, legal limit amp. A natural choice for me was the RF Concepts Company-Alpha given their solid products, excellent reputation, service/repair, and superb customer relations/support (Molly).
The Alpha 99 has been around for a while now and seems to continually be a highly, sought after amplifier on the used market,... holding its value very well.
Compared to the 91B (Bulgarian-made), the 99 (Made in USA) has the Hypersil Peter Dahl transformer and some other differing parts. Both 91B and 99 use the same rugged and dependable Russian tubes, but there is just something about the stamp on the back that reads,...'Longmont, CO'.
I researched this amplifier for a long time and made several contacts with Molly about possibly purchasing a newer 8410. I decided to go with a used 99 instead due to its great reputation and storied reliability. The 8410 in itself, was designed off of the 99's chassis and platform.
I strongly recommend this amplifier if you are looking for legal limit,...it loafs all day long @ 1.5kW with 40-50W exciter drive.
Considered a 'Legacy' amp by RF Concepts-Alpha, parts seem readily available if there is a future problem. The blower in mine started to rattle so I ordered a new one. Installation was a snap and now whisper quiet.
I am looking forward to many years of service with this truly, wonderful amplifier.

SM3LGO Rating: 2012-05-05
Ask me Time Owned: 6 to 12 months.
Have had this amp for a year now (bought it directly from RF Concepts) and am very, very happy with it. (It has serial number 499, it's the second to last ever made from what I understand.)

The only slight "issue" I can think of is that it draws a lot of current from the AC line. When the amp is keyed, the AC supply line voltage drops from 217V to 207V. But this is the house wiring's fault rather than the amp's. RF Concepts recommended me to try wiring the amp for 200V instead of 220V in order to achieve the nominal 1500W output, which I haven't tried yet. I now get 1200-1300W which I think suffices.
All in all, I would not hesitate to recommend you to buy this amp if you can find one. It feels really robust and operates quietly.
